Preparing Sharpening Up For a the frontend web interview can seems daunting, but a structured approach method will significantly really boost your chances . Focus Concentrate on mastering fundamental JavaScript concepts, including closures, prototypes, and asynchronous coding – these are often hot topics. Furthermore, practice tackle common algorithm puzzles and data structure to demonstrate prove your problem-solving . Don’t forget overlook to review popular frontend tools, like frontend developer interview course india React , and be prepared to discuss your knowledge of them. Finally, mock interviews practice sessions are incredibly valuable for refining your communication skills and reducing .
Expert Scripting Proficiency for Client-side Engineers
To truly thrive as a UI engineer, achieving advanced JavaScript mastery is vital . This involves transcending the fundamentals and understanding topics like scope , prototypal programming , asynchronous processes , advanced techniques, and innovative tools including Vue. Moreover, a thorough understanding of optimization and testing strategies will significantly boost your capabilities and place you apart.
DSA for Frontend
To become a capable frontend developer , establishing a solid foundation in Data Structures and Algorithms is absolutely essential . While often thought of as backend programming, understanding basic DSA ideas can greatly improve your ability to craft efficient frontend applications . It helps you select better selections regarding data organization and algorithm implementation , ultimately leading to a more robust and maintainable frontend experience .
User Interface to End-to-End: Architectural Basics
Transitioning from a frontend focus to a full-stack role demands a more extensive comprehension of design concepts . You'll need to investigate beyond markup, styling, and scripting and delve into backend technologies like PHP, Ruby, or Go . Key areas to consider include database architecture , application building, server solutions, and basic safety procedures . Gaining this holistic perspective is critical for effectively creating robust software .
Elevate Your Client-Side Expertise: Advanced JavaScript & Algorithmic Solutions and Computational Methods
Ready to move beyond the basics? Refine your frontend development abilities with a dive into advanced JavaScript and Data Organization and Programming Techniques . This journey provides opportunities to build more optimized and scalable applications. Mastering these topics allows you to address challenging problems and become a in-demand developer. Consider these areas for additional learning:
- Delving into function scope and prototypal inheritance
- Designing algorithmic solutions like connected nodes and trees
- Assessing computational methods for organizing and locating
- Leveraging asynchronous JavaScript for responsive applications
By integrating expert JavaScript knowledge with a solid understanding of Data Organization and Computational Methods, you’ll unlock the potential to create truly impressive software . This commitment in your education will offer rewards significantly.
Web Developer's System Architecture Course
Are you a aspiring frontend engineer looking to level up your skillset beyond basic HTML, CSS, and JavaScript? Our intensive Web System Architecture Bootcamp provides a practical, hands-on framework to understanding and building scalable and resilient web platforms . You’ll explore crucial concepts like scalability , API integration, data modeling, and technical patterns – all through real-world exercises . This isn’t just about writing ; it’s about thinking like a senior engineer .